Job Details
The Senior Network & Systems Administrator is responsible for effectively provisioning, installing/configuring, operating, and maintaining system hardware, software, and related infrastructure systems. This individual researches, recommends, and implements processes and tools to continuously improve the infrastructure. This individual ensures that system hardware, operating systems, software systems, and related procedures adhere to organizational values and standards.
Individuals in this position are expected to support project efforts by performing the technical analysis, design, build, test, and implementation tasks. Additionally, as needed, this individual will provide second-level support for end user issues.
This individual is responsible for administering the following environments:
- Windows server environment
- Nimble Storage environment
- Virtual server environment
- Data network
- Application systems and tools that support the infrastructure environment
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Recommend and follow technical standards for system configuration.
- Document technical configurations.
- Install and configure servers and necessary applications.
- Configure and monitor backup/recovery of systems.
- Proactively monitor system stathealth and address issues as appropriate.
- Perform system upgrades and patches as necessary to include firmware, operating system, and applications.
- Engage with vendors for license renewals, hardware/software, and support contracts.
- Support help desk personnel as necessary to resolve end user issues.
- Ensure security standards and practices are implemented and maintained within the infrastructure environment.
- Administer Microsoft Office 365 environment.
- Sets up, configures, and supports internal and/or external networks
- Develops and maintains all security and network configurations
- Troubleshoots network performance issues
- Creates, maintains, and exercises a disaster recovery plan
- Individual is expected to be generally available 24 x 7 x 365 in case of emergency.
